Actavis: The Codeine King?

For a brief period in the early 2010s, Actavis became synonymous with codeine cough syrup. Its products, particularly Promethazine with Codeine Syrup, gained popularity amongst certain demographics, fueling a cultural moment that permeated music. Some argue that Actavis's marketing and distribution strategies inadvertently contributed to the codeine syrup epidemic, turning Actavis into a controversial figure.

Riding the Wave: The Dangers of Actavis Abuse

Actavis. The name sparks a hunger in those who've fallen prey to its insidious hold. This potent brew of prescription cough syrup, laced with dangerous doses of codeine and promethazine, promises an escape from reality. Users crave the blissful euphoria it offers, a temporary bliss they foolishly believe is worth the risk. But beneath the surface lies a dark truth: addiction.

  • The cycle of dependence can escalate rapidly, leaving users trapped in a unending struggle for their next fix.
  • Physical effects range from drowsiness and nausea to debilitating liver damage.
  • Chronic abuse can cause havoc on the brain, leading to memory loss, depression, and even overdose.
